Abstract

Disease prevention and control is a fundamental component of public health that encompasses a variety of strategies and measures aimed at reducing the incidence, prevalence, morbidity and mortality of diseases in the population. In this essay, we will explore the main disease prevention and control strategies, their importance in public health and their application in contemporary practice.
